Viral video showed man dragging elderly woman with her hair on street and torturing her


Sialkot: In another inhumane act reported as an elderly woman was brutally tortured over land dispute in Sialkot.
According to the reports, an aged woman dragged and beaten up openly on a road in Sialkot. The unfortunate incident which was captured on camera occurred due to the land dispute.
The viral video showed a man dragging an elderly woman with her hair on the street and torturing her. It also emerged that other than the man, two women were also involved in beating up the aged woman with shoes.
The women later also used rods to beat her. No one in the crowd stopped the attackers from beating a woman and continued to film the horrific act.
Later, the police arrested five accused who were involved in torture. As per police, the incident was happened before many days and they registered a case against 15 person including women.
The special team formed by DPO Sialkot took action and rounded up five accused those tortured on woman publically. Four woman among a man included in the arrested accused.

DPO Sialkot Umer Saeed said that the teams are conducting search operation to arrest other accused those involved in the incident. “All accused will be trailed and justice will be provided to the victim,” he assured.
It is pertinent to mention here that IG Punjab earlier took the notice of this matter and ordered to arrest the accused those tortured on aged woman.
